Whether resolution for alteration of object clause of Memorandum of Association is required to be passed through Postal Ballot Resolution or can it be passed in Annual General Meeting or Extra Ordinary General Meeting?
01 March 2011
Yes required to be passed through postal ballot.
The Companies (Passing of the Resolution by Postal Ballot) Rules, 2001
3. Applications:- These Rules shall be applicable to listed companies and in case of resolutions relating to such businesses as are specified under rule 4.
4. List of businesses in which the resolutions shall be passed through Postal Ballot. (a)alteration in the Object Clause of Memorandum; (b)alteration of Articles of Associations in relation to insertion of provisions defining private company; (c)buy-back of own shares by the company under sub-section (1) of section 77A; (d)issue of shares with differential voting rights as to voting or dividend or other wise under sub-clause (ii) of clause (a) of section 86; (e)change in place of Registered Office out side local limits of any city, town or village as specified in sub-section (2) of section 146; (f)sale of whole or substantially the whole of undertaking of a company as specified under sub-clause (a) of sub-section (1) of section 293; (g)giving loans or extending guarantee or providing security in excess of the limit prescribed under sub-section (1) of section 372A; (h)* election of a director under proviso to sub-section (1) of section 252 of the Act” ; (i)* deleted w.e.f. 11/10/2001 (j)variation in the rights attached to a class of shares or debentures or other securities as specified under section 106.
